Handover: soft deletes on the Pellaro orders table. Rows now get deleted_at instead of hard DELETE; a purge job hard-removes after 90 days. Security-relevant bits: deleted rows still readable by any service with table access until purge, and the export API doesn't filter them yet — fix pending. Audit trigger logs who set deleted_at. Review the purge job's grants before sign-off. Schema diff, access matrix, and purge schedule are on the internal page below.

wiki page, tahaf-tajog: https://jira.ordindyn.corp/pipeline

Action item from the Feedwright validator outage: the RSS enclosure parser timed out on oversized podcast feeds because our retry and size limits were never revisited after the Larkspur migration. Before the next release, please confirm the updated constants match staging. The values we settled on after load testing are as follows.

limits module of tafop-hahop:
WEIGHTS = {
    "julmir": 223,
    "belox": 987,
    "lamion": 470,
    "pelath": 609,
    "fraok": 1010,
    "eliion": 343,
    "drudor": 342,
}

[ ] Verify Fernbolt device-firmware update channel integrity. Confirm staged rollout gates are enabled, rollback images signed, and the Harwick relay mirrors in sync. Support: do not instruct customers to force-update until this item is checked off. Any failed OTA reports should be logged and escalated immediately to the channel owner identified below.

approver of tagef-hawef = Oliok Julath